What to Check on Any T-Type

These cars share a structure, and they share its weaknesses. Whichever model you are looking at, these are the checks that decide whether you are buying a car or a project. Read this first, then read the guide for your model.

The ash frame — this is the one that matters

A T-Type's body tub is a skeleton of ash with metal panels tacked onto it. The chassis beneath is steel; the tub is wood. Rain gets between the two and begins separating them, and these cars were never remotely waterproof — the hoods and side curtains seal poorly at the best of times. Morgan reckon a wood frame needs replacing every seven years if a car lives outdoors. A T-Type that has been garaged, or spent its life in a dry climate, is worth a real premium; one that has sat outside needs excellent provenance or a recent, documented restoration.

Look around and between the A- and B-posts first. The wood below there is exposed and is usually the first to rot. Then get underneath: the large main wood rails running down each side are visible from below, and most of the rest is hidden behind metal, so this is your best honest view of the frame.

Doors that have dropped are the first sign of structural trouble.

Open and close both doors. Slight movement is acceptable; sloppiness is not. Then stand back and sight along the car — if the body lines don't align, something is wrong with the frame. Be aware that the ash frame on almost any surviving T-Type has been rebuilt or replaced at some point, and there is plenty of scope for that work to have left it neither straight nor symmetrical.

Two quick tests tell you a great deal. First, take hold of the scuttle — the panel below the windscreen — and try to rock it gently from side to side: on a car whose body-tub timber has rotted, it will move, and in a bad case move alarmingly. Second, check that the seam where the bonnet's top panel meets its side panels lines up with the seam on the scuttle just below the windscreen pillars. If those lines don't meet, the body frame has moved, or been rebuilt out of true.

A complete new timber skeleton costs somewhere around £5,000 as a kit, before anyone fits it — and fitting is labour-intensive work that is not for the faint-hearted. Price accordingly.

Rust, where it does occur

Rot matters more than rust on these cars, but rust still finds the doors, the bottom of the cowl, the area behind the fuel tank, and along the skirt. These cars have very little suspension travel and take a beating on poor roads; the result shows up as loose panel fit.

The chassis

Generally strong, and small repairs are straightforward. Cracks do appear — notably on TDs and TFs below the scuttle, where the main rails change from box section to channel section. Look there specifically.

Accident damage is the greater worry. Sight along the full length of the rails for deformation. A bent chassis can be straightened, but the body has to come off to do it, which makes it practical only as part of a full rebuild.

Suspension, steering and wheels

The suspension is robust. Check for play in the kingpins, perished rubber bushes (badly worn ones will clonk on a test drive), and leaking lever-arm dampers.

On earlier cars with a steering box, some play at the wheel rim is normal — up to three inches is acceptable, though less is much preferable.

With wire wheels, tap each spoke and listen: you want a consistent twang from one to the next, which tells you the tensions are even. A clonk as you pull away points to worn splines in the wheel centres, or in the hubs they sit on, or both. Whatever the cause, it needs fixing.

Engines

Both the XPAG/XPEG and the earlier MPJG are straightforward and mostly robust — with one important exception on each. The original XPAG crankshaft is a known weak spot, so receipts for a modern high-strength replacement are a genuine plus rather than a red flag. Gearboxes

No T-Type has synchromesh on first gear, and the earliest TAs have it only on the top two. You will need to double-declutch. This is a feature, not a fault, but know it before you drive one.

Electrics

The Lucas wiring on a T-Type is refreshingly simple — headlights, side and tail lights, wipers and a horn, with indicators added on later TDs and TFs — and, properly maintained, it is not the horror story the old jokes suggest. The real risk is rarely the original system; it is what has been done to it since. Treat modern crimp-on connectors, patches spliced into the harness, unexplained switches under the dash and in-line fuses as red flags — they usually mark a bodged repair rather than an upgrade. A car still on a sound original-style harness is worth more than one hiding a loom of previous owners' fixes, and a full replacement harness is the proper cure where one is needed.

Modifications

Unless you are looking at a reputable, documented restoration, expect a surprising number of modifications — some sympathetic, some emphatically not. Seventy years is a long time. What matters is knowing what has been done and why.

Originality and interior

On cars this age, originality is worth checking as carefully as condition. The instruments are a known weak point — the combined oil-pressure and water-temperature gauge in particular, where one side almost always fails before the other; remanufactured and NOS units exist, but factor a tired gauge into your offer. Know what is correct before you judge a car: no T-Type left the factory with a black interior, vinyl roofs are wrong, and the carpet should not be trimmed to fit. The dashboard is wood, but was always covered to match the trim. A full tonneau cover was offered on the TF but not on the earlier cars, so its presence or absence is a period detail, not a fault.

Before you commit

Get the car's factory production record from the MG Car Club's T Register, and have the car inspected by someone who knows T-Types. This guide is general enthusiast information, not professional mechanical advice, and no web page substitutes for a specialist with a torch and a screwdriver.
